Latur Bike Rally On Milad-Un-Nabi Going Viral As Election Rally By Congress In Maharashtra.

As the Maharashtra Assembly Elections are approaching, various posts went viral on social media regarding the elections. One such post came to our notice where a video of a big bike rally was shown. Sharing the video on social media users are claiming that the video shows an election rally by the Congress party in Maharashtra. Sharing the video, a Facebook user wrote, “Election rally of the congress party in Maharashtra. Look closely and you won’t find any India flag there. Vote wisely.”

However, as we investigated, we came to know that the claim was false. The video has no link to the upcoming elections in Maharashtra. Here’s the fact check.

Fact Check

We started our investigation by taking some screenshots from the viral video and conducting a reverse image search. This led us to a YouTube channel where the viral video was uploaded on 1 October 2024. According to the caption, the video was from Milad-Un-Nabi processions in Latur Maharashtra.

Taking this clue, we conducted a relevant keyword search. This led us to a vlog uploaded on YouTube on 20 September 2024. The video shows the same rally as the viral video but is shot from a different angle and place. 

We could the same black car and the person through the sunroof holding a flag in this video. According to the caption, the video shows a rally on the occasion of Milad-Un-Nabi. A comparison between the two screenshots can be seen below.

Moving forward, we found a video report uploaded on Latur News Official YouTube channel on 19 September 2024. The caption read, “लातूर मध्ये ईद मिलादुन्नबी ची बाईक रॅली | Eid Milad Rally Latur | Latur News Official”

Further, we found other videos from the same bike rally that mentioned it to be from the Latur Milad-Un-Nabi rally.

For more information, we contacted the Latur Police. Latur Police Inspector Premprakash
Marotrao Makode said, “This procession is part of a bike rally organized on the occasion of
Eid-e-Milad on September 19. There is social harmony in Latur as Ganesh Visarjan and Eid-
e-Milad coincide. Therefore, every year Hindu and Muslim communities agree on two
separate days for taking out the procession here. This year also the first Ganesh Visarjan
was held on 17th September and then on 19th September a bike rally was held on the
occasion of Eid-e-Milad”.

This makes it clear that the viral video is from the Latur Maharashtra Miladunnabi bike rally.

Conclusion 

From our investigation, we can say that the claim is false. The video is not showing a congress rally in Maharashtra. The video shows a bike rally on the occasion of Miladunnabi in Latur Maharashtra.
